We're trying to install Palm Tungsten on WIndows XP. During the software install from the CDROM (perhaps 3 screen into the install wizard) their is a BSOD STOP ERROR 0x8e. Originally booting into Safe Mode and trying to install the software produced: 1607 unable to install, installshiel scripting runtime. We installed IsScript7.zip which installed the proper version of the installshield for the system but running the Tungsten install was impossible in safe mode.

Any ideas on how to resolve this. No other problems in installing software has occured on the pc

My guess is that there's a corrupted file on the install CD. You can sometimes get around this problem by copying the entire CD to a temporary directory of your PC and doing the install from there. If that still doesn't work, you should call Palm support and discuss this with them. It may be that you need a new driver for your CD or a new CD from Palm.
